Washington Code § 46.16A.440

Private use, single-axle trailers—Reduced license fee

Private use single-axle trailers of two thousand pounds scale weight or less may qualify for a reduced vehicle license fee described in RCW 46.17.350(1)(k). To qualify for the reduced vehicle license fee: (1) The trailer must be operated upon public highways; (2) The vehicle license fee must be collected annually for each registration year or fraction of a registration year; and (3) The trailer must be operated for personal use of the owner and not held for rental to the public or used in any commercial or business endeavor.
